A GRE consists of three sections namely analytical reasoning, verbal reasoning, and quantitative reasoning. Many of the individuals face problems in the verbal reasoning section. The verbal reasoning section is further divided into three types of questions namely reading comprehension, text completion, and sentence equivalence. Below is a series of tips for those individuals who face difficulties in dealing with the verbal reasoning section of a GRE:
- Improve vocabulary- The major thing that one should keep in mind is to improve vocabulary. One must have a good hold on idioms as well. One must maintain a separate notebook for the same to regularly practice the words whenever and in whatever situation possible. A person is seen to be a knowledgeable individual if he or she has a good command over language along with a good vocabulary.
- Improve pace- One must focus on improving the pace in solving the questions. Every individual has been in a position of not having the option to let go of a difficult question, consuming so much of the time over it. To excel on the test one need to get a feeling of pacing, so one doesn’t invest the majority of their energy in just a couple of inquiries. There are a few GRE practice tests out there that will help an individual or assist an individual with understanding any time issues. The better is an individual question-solving speed, the more time he or she would be able to spare for revision.
